Output 7dda8142ea633694d9ef52468c5e2c6753264f85f8011320d213f6b14b3a2bb7:7

value
18260083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ee206b379eeb72e7f270479d67732630324aede OP_EQUAL
address
35xumwb6juM9qh3ZKXPwyw8YcAK6j11BMn
transaction
7dda8142ea633694d9ef52468c5e2c6753264f85f8011320d213f6b14b3a2bb7
spent
true